Sir, I recently did an executive health check up. All my tests are normal except for high cholesterol. I am attaching the report for reference. Could you please advise what steps I should take to lower my cholesterol? Is this a serious issue, or can it be managed with exercise and a proper diet? My doctor has also advised taking Razel 10 mg daily at night. Please guide me
Answered by 1 Apollo Doctors
If only cholesterol is raised and all other tests are normal, it can often be managed through diet and exercise. Start with 30 to 45 minutes of walking, cut down on fried food, red meat, and sweets. Lipid Profile should be repeated after 3 months of lifestyle change. If the doctor has advised Razel 10 mg, continue it alongside diet control. It is not serious unless other heart risks (BP, diabetes) are present.
